    "The Kentucky Volunteer" is a song published in the United States on January 6, 1794. Its music was composed by Raynor Taylor and its lyrics by "a Lady of Philadelphia". [1] It is noteworthy for being the first musical composition copyrighted under the new United States Constitution . [2]

    The President's Volunteer Service Award is a civil award bestowed by the President of the United States. Established by executive order by George W. Bush , the award was established to honor volunteers that give hundreds of hours per year helping others through the President's Council on Service and Civic Participation .

    The National Volunteer Fire Council (NVFC) is the leading 501 (c) (3) nonprofit membership association representing the interests of the volunteer fire, EMS, and rescue services.     National Volunteer Week. National Volunteer Week is an annual celebration observed in many countries, to promote and show appreciation for volunteerism and volunteering. In the United States, it is organized by the Points of Light foundation, and in Canada by Volunteer Canada. [1] It is held in those two countries in mid to late April.

    AmeriCorps VISTA is a national service program designed to alleviate poverty. President John F. Kennedy originated the idea for VISTA, which was founded as Volunteers in Service to America in 1965, and incorporated into the AmeriCorps network of programs in 1993. [1] VISTA is an acronym for Volunteers in Service to America.
